Another question that often arises is: How can I ensure that my compassion is genuine and not just a superficial response? The key here is to listen actively and empathetically. Empathy is not just about feeling sorry for someone; its about understanding their emotions and experiences.
In my experience, this meant taking the time to really listen to the familys struggles, acknowledging their feelings, and validating their experiences. It also involved asking openended questions and showing genuine interest in their lives. This not only helped the family feel understood but also allowed me to provide more personalized support.
One of the most valuable lessons I learned from the Compassion Game was the importance of selfcompassion. Selfcompassion is the practice of being kind to oneself in moments of suffering, especially when dealing with compassion fatigue. Its about treating yourself with the same kindness and understanding you would offer a good friend.
